Alfajores

By Roadjunky, Posted Dec 23, 2008

Argentine alfajores

Yummy!

Argentines drink a lot of coffee and smoke a lot of cigarettes. They wash down tons of beef with gallons of wine. So it is no surprise they indulge themselves when it comes to sweets too. Hence, the alfajor.

Alfajores are cookies stuck together with dulce de leche (a sweet, sticky milk) and covered in chocolate. They taste like a field of sugar cane exploding in your mouth and you will need to counterbalance it with bitter, black coffee.
